[32][33], The George Olah carbon dioxide recycling plant operated by Carbon Recycling International in Grindavk, Iceland, has been producing 2 million liters of methanol transportation fuel per year from flue exhaust of the Svartsengi Power Station since 2011. [15], Methanol can be made from a chemical reaction of a carbon-dioxide molecule with three hydrogen molecules to produce methanol and water. Such reactions are exothermic and use about 3mol of hydrogen per mole of carbon dioxide involved. Carbon Engineering, a Canadian company, is already making a liquid fuel by sucking carbon dioxide (CO2) out of the atmosphere and combining it with hydrogen from water.
